Why Is My VPN Not Working on Vodafone Germany?

When your VPN not working message pops up, Vodafone Germany is usually the culprit. Internet service providers in Germany are legally obligated to enforce geo-blocking for services like Sky Go. To do this, Vodafone employs sophisticated Deep Packet Inspection (DPI) to identify and throttle or block VPN traffic. They recognize the unique signatures of VPN protocols and can even block the IP addresses of known VPN servers. This is why you might connect to a server only to find your streaming service completely inaccessible or your connection painfully slow.

Adding to the complexity, some VPNs struggle with DNS leaks. This occurs when your device bypasses the VPN's encrypted tunnel and sends your DNS queries directly to Vodafone's servers. Sky Go then sees your true German location, even if your VPN IP is from another country, and will block the stream. Ensuring your VPN has robust DNS leak protection is non-negotiable.

Step-by-Step Fixes for a VPN Not Working

Don't cancel your subscription just yet. Follow this troubleshooting list to regain control of your connection.

1. Switch Your VPN Server or Protocol

The first and easiest fix is to simply connect to a different server, preferably one optimized for streaming. If that doesn't work, the protocol is key. Many VPNs default to OpenVPN, which is easily detected. Switch to a more stealthy protocol like WireGuard or the provider's own obfuscated servers (sometimes called “Stealth” or “NoBorders” mode). These protocols mask VPN traffic to make it look like regular internet traffic, effectively bypassing Vodafone's DPI filters.

2. Enable DNS Leak Protection

A VPN connection is useless if your DNS is leaking. Go into your VPN application's settings and ensure that a “DNS Leak Protection” or “Kill Switch” feature is enabled. This forces all network traffic through the VPN tunnel and automatically disconnects you if the VPN drops, preventing any data from being exposed. You can verify your DNS is secure by visiting a DNS leak test website after connecting.

3. Change Your DNS Servers Manually

If your VPN app's DNS protection isn't enough, you can manually configure your device to use a third-party DNS service like Cloudflare (1.1.1.1) or Google DNS (8.8.8.8). This ensures your device never uses Vodafone's DNS servers by default. Combine this with your active VPN connection for a powerful one-two punch against geo-blocks and tracking.

4. Check for IPV6 Leaks

Many older VPNs only handle IPv4 traffic, while Vodafone uses IPv6. This can cause an IPv6 leak, where your device's IPv6 address, which reveals your location, is exposed. The solution is to disable IPv6 on your device or use a VPN that explicitly supports and manages IPv6 connections to prevent this type of leak.

Advanced Troubleshooting: When Basic Fixes Fail

If you've tried everything and your VPN is still not working, it's time to dig deeper.

Check Your Firewall and Antivirus

Sometimes, the software designed to protect you can interfere. Your firewall or antivirus suite might be blocking the VPN's connection. Try temporarily disabling these programs (ensure you are on a safe network) to see if the VPN connects. If it does, you can add your VPN application to the software's whitelist or allowlist.

Reinstall the VPN Application

A corrupted installation can cause a myriad of issues. Completely uninstall your VPN software, download the latest version fresh from the provider's official website, and reinstall it. This often clears up persistent connection glitches.

Try a Different Device or Network

To isolate the problem, try connecting with your VPN on a different device, like your phone using mobile data instead of your Vodafone Wi-Fi. If it works there, the issue is almost certainly with your home network setup, pointing back to Vodafone's network-level blocking.
